#include "hip_module_common.hh"
#include <hip_test_common.hh>
#include <hip_test_defgroups.hh>
/**
* @addtogroup hipModuleGetFunctionCount hipModuleGetFunctionCount
* @{
* @ingroup ModuleTest
* `hipError_t hipModuleGetFunctionCount (unsigned int* count, hipModule_t mod)`
* - Returns the number of functions within a module
*/
/**
* Test Description
* ------------------------
* - Test case verifies the below positive cases of hipModuleGetFunctionCount
* API.
* - Get the device count from different kinds of modules.
* 1. Module is built for Single architecture which contain Single global
* function
* 2. Module is built for multi architecture which contain Single global
* function
* 3. Empty Module which doesn't contain any function.
* 4. Module which contain both __global__, __device__ functions in it.
* 5. RTC module.
* Test source
* ------------------------
* - catch/unit/module/hipModuleGetFunctionCount.cc
* Test requirements
* ------------------------
* - HIP_VERSION >= 7.1
*/
TEST_CASE("Unit_hipModuleGetFunctionCount_Functional") {
CTX_CREATE();
hipModule_t moduleSingleArch, moduleEmpty, doubleKernelModule, rtcModule;
unsigned int count = 0;
SECTION("Single arch, Single global function") {
HIP_CHECK(hipModuleLoad(&moduleSingleArch, "vcpy_kernel.code"));
HIP_CHECK(hipModuleGetFunctionCount(&count, moduleSingleArch));
REQUIRE(count == 1);
HIP_CHECK(hipModuleUnload(moduleSingleArch));
}
#if HT_AMD
SECTION("Multi arch, Single global function") {
hipModule_t moduleMultiArch;
const auto loaded_module =
LoadModuleIntoBuffer("copyKernelCompressed.code");
HIP_CHECK(hipModuleLoadData(&moduleMultiArch, loaded_module.data()));
HIP_CHECK(hipModuleGetFunctionCount(&count, moduleMultiArch));
REQUIRE(count == 1);
HIP_CHECK(hipModuleUnload(moduleMultiArch));
}
#endif
SECTION("Empty Module Count") {
HIP_CHECK(hipModuleLoad(&moduleEmpty, "emptyModuleCount.code"));
HIP_CHECK(hipModuleGetFunctionCount(&count, moduleEmpty));
REQUIRE(count == 0);
HIP_CHECK(hipModuleUnload(moduleEmpty));
}
SECTION("__global__, __device__ functions module") {
HIP_CHECK(hipModuleLoad(&doubleKernelModule, "kernel_count.code"));
HIP_CHECK(hipModuleGetFunctionCount(&count, doubleKernelModule));
REQUIRE(count == 1);
HIP_CHECK(hipModuleUnload(doubleKernelModule));
}
SECTION("Load RTCd module") {
const auto rtc =
CreateRTCCharArray(R"(extern "C" __global__ void kernel() {})");
HIP_CHECK(hipModuleLoadData(&rtcModule, rtc.data()));
REQUIRE(rtcModule != nullptr);
HIP_CHECK(hipModuleGetFunctionCount(&count, rtcModule));
REQUIRE(count == 1);
HIP_CHECK(hipModuleUnload(rtcModule));
}
CTX_DESTROY();
}
/**
* Test Description
* ------------------------
* - Test case verifies the negative case of hipModuleGetFunctionCount API.
* Test source
* ------------------------
* - catch/unit/module/hipModuleGetFunctionCount.cc
* Test requirements
* ------------------------
* - HIP_VERSION >= 7.1
*/
TEST_CASE("Unit_hipModuleGetFunctionCount_NegativeTsts") {
unsigned int count = 0;
SECTION("Input module as nullptr") {
HIP_CHECK_ERROR(hipModuleGetFunctionCount(&count, nullptr),
hipErrorInvalidHandle);
}
}
